What Causes Non Functional Kidney After Treated Urinal Infections?
Hello Doctor , My sister aged 56 was suffering from urinal infection since last 2 years on and off.. She has been taking medicines for the same . Today her Nephroligist says her left kidney is totally dead non functional and has to be removed within 2-3 months .. My Queries : 1) How come all of a sudden we come to know of this , inspire of regularly visiting a renowned Neohroligist. 2) Can there be any chances of revival of the dead kidney ? 3) If not , then should it be removed / when ? 4 ) what should we do ? a non functioning kidney can be due to chronic obstruction or chronic infection. non functioning kidney cannot be revived anymore. if the non functioning kidney is the cause of your recurrent UTI then it should be removed to prevent UTI and preservation of the remaining good kidney.
